Analogues of cliques for oriented coloring

open access: yesDiscussiones Mathematicae Graph Theory, 2004
Considered are subgraphs of oriented graphs in the context of oriented colouring that are analogous to cliques in traditional vertex colouring. Bounds on the sizes of these subgraphs are given for planar, outerplaner and series-parallel graphs. Further Results on the 3-Consecutive Vertex Coloring Number of Certain Graphs

open access: yesIEEE Access
A 3-consecutive vertex coloring is an assignment of colors on vertices of a graph G such that for any 3-consecutive vertices $a, b$ and c, the color of b is the same as the color of a or c.

Clique coloring $B_1$-EPG graphs

open access: yes, 2017
We consider the problem of clique coloring, that is, coloring the vertices of a given graph such that no (maximal) clique of size at least two is monocolored. It is known that interval graphs are $2$-clique colorable.
